Time Out says
Details
- Address
- 39 Upper Street
- London
- N1 0PN
- Transport:
- Tube: Angel tube
- Price:
- Main courses £7.75-£10.50.
- Opening hours:
- Meals served noon-11pm Mon-Sat; noon-10pm Sun.
Discover Time Out original video
Discover Time Out original video